The AZURE SUMMIT TECHNOLOGY, INC. 401(k) on its latest Form 5500
AZURE SUMMIT TECHNOLOGY, INC. (EIN 26-0528644) reports AZURE SUMMIT TECHNOLOGY, INC. 401(K) RETIREMENT PLAN on its most recent Form 5500, with $24.3M in plan assets across 289 active participants. Form 5500 is the annual report employers file with the U.S. Department of Labor for their retirement plans, and it’s public.

Who runs the AZURE SUMMIT TECHNOLOGY, INC. 401(k)?
The plan’s recordkeeper — the firm that runs the website and statements where you check your balance, change contributions, and manage your account — is Fidelity, based on the plan’s Schedule C service-provider disclosure. That’s the login you use for your AZURE SUMMIT TECHNOLOGY, INC. 401(k).
